Ori Laizerouvich (; born 30 April 1987) is an Israeli actor and comedian. He is best known for starring in the hit Israeli comedy series, ''
Shababnikim'' (2017–present).

Personal life
In 2021, Laizerouvich got engaged to his partner, Erez Berger, and on March 4, 2022, the pair married. In November 2023, the couple welcomed a son.
